What fence materials work best with Algonquin's soil and pests?

Algonquin's moderate soil corrosivity and moderate-to-heavy termite risk dictate material choice. Pressure-treated pine posts must have UC4B ground contact rating. For metal components, G90 galvanization is the minimum standard to prevent rust. Use stainless steel or triple-coated screws for fasteners; standard zinc-coated screws will corrode and cause unsightly rust streaks on the fence within two seasons.

Is my fence built to withstand high winds?

A fence in Algonquin must be engineered for the V-ult wind speed of 115 mph. This rating dictates structural requirements: post spacing no greater than 8 feet on-center, concrete footings as specified, and the use of heavy-duty post brackets or through-bolt connections. These measures ensure the fence can survive peak storm season gusts without panel failure or posts snapping at the base.

How deep should my fence posts be set in Algonquin, MD?

Post footings in Algonquin must extend a minimum of 30 inches below grade to get below the frost line. Following IRC Figure R507.4, this depth prevents frost heave that lifts posts out of alignment.
